    @AntonioTuzzi 3 роки тому +12

    Another nice trick
    1) import a nice 4 on the floor or similar beat
    2) trim the PEAK to get on the correct HOT spots
    3) connect the peak trig to AR envelope and to a Sequencer
    4) drive a bass and filter it and dynamic with PEAK CV out
    and you have a walking bass all along the sample

    @AntonioTuzzi 3 роки тому +7

    in version 1.0.17
    I have debugged the envFollower (now no more BIZARRE oscillation at the start) (with smoothing is perfect)
    and added a RAMP representing the position of the playhead
    both outputs can be used to have important effects applied in sync with samples
